  • At the recommendation of our photographer, we ordered our prints and photo albums from Adoramapix.com. We really wanted an affordable, DIY flush-mount album with a professional look and OMG we love our album! Their customer service was absolutely amazing (a 30% off coupon popped up 2 days after we ordered our album + 3 parent albums and they credited our account as soon as we asked!) We did 10x10, 38-page albums for our parents and a 12x12, 54 page album for our own wedding album. We got all 4 albums under $300, which sounds a bit pricey, but the album is definitely more of a professional grade than a snapfish/shutterfly album. Their site was really used friendly and had a lot of customizing options. I am NOT at all very tech-savvy and I didn't find the site too hard to use.
